What Telehealth Means for Families

Telehealth refers to the use of encrypted digital platforms to deliver mental health services without a traditional office setting. For family therapy, this translates to joining your loved ones on a HIPAA-compliant platform where a credentialed counselor facilitates the conversation just as they might in the office. Households across Cerritos, Lakewood, and Norwalk continue to use this format since it cuts out the scheduling friction that frequently get in the way of consistent attendance.

These platforms employed at Eye Cue Mental Health is fully HIPAA-compliant, which means your personal discussions are protected from start to finish. Compared to a ordinary video call, a HIPAA-compliant platform protects all data so that personal household content is kept private. This standard of privacy is necessary when exploring vulnerable topics that come up in family therapy.

How HIPAA-Compliant Platforms Protect Your Family

Privacy is essential in any counseling setting, and it feels particularly vital in family therapy where more than one individuals are disclosing private concerns. A HIPAA-compliant platform ensures that no third individuals can access your sessions. At Eye Cue Mental Health, every virtual therapy session takes place through a platform that complies with federal data protection regulations.

Remote Mental Health for Diverse Family Structures

Online therapy services are notably beneficial for families with diverse arrangements. Co-parenting families where participants reside in multiple locations, such as a caregiver in Long Beach and the other in Whittier, can still join the same family therapy session with no need for either party commuting far from home. Eye Cue Mental Health helps make this possible through its dependable virtual platform.

Extended families spread across Cerritos, Anaheim, and Buena Park also benefit from the ability to join remotely. Older family members who have difficulty with transportation and college-age members no longer local can continue to be present in meaningful family therapy conversations. This reach reinforces the counseling outcomes for the whole family group.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are virtual family therapy sessions equally effective as in-person sessions?

Clinical evidence strongly suggests that virtual therapy sessions can be just as beneficial as in-person sessions for many clients. The therapeutic bond holds strong through a HIPAA-compliant platform, and Eye Cue Mental Health counselors are trained in conducting effective remote mental health appointments.

What devices does my family use for online family counseling?

The majority of families only need a tablet with a functioning webcam and a reliable internet service. Eye Cue Mental Health walks every family through the process before their first session, making sure all participants joins and without technology problems.
